Ticket: Missed laptop return pick-up – Dock 4

Hey — the Fernley Leasing courier never showed for yesterday's laptop collection at Dock 4. We've got 22 units boxed and pallet-wrapped, taking up space we need by Thursday. Fernley says they've rebooked for tomorrow between 10:00 and noon, new driver. Can you keep the pallet staged near the roller door and have someone around to sign? Don't release anything without the manifest matching the box count. When the driver arrives, apply the hand-over instruction below exactly as written.

handover note for yagef-bagep: the drudor pelius courier leaves the kasdor zorvan norir ledger at gate 8016 under passcode 755406

Welcome to the Bannerly team at Quillhaven Software. We're rolling out the new consent banner across all Lanternfold-hosted sites this quarter. Your first task is to verify banner variants render correctly in the staging preview tool. Staging requests go through the Consentry gateway, which requires authentication on every call. Use the key below for staging access.

app token of badug-tahaf = qvz11-nP5FBNr8qnh

Confirm thumbnail generation queue (Pellstrom ImageFlow) rejects unsigned payloads and enforces per-tenant size caps before release. Verify dead-letter routing drops EXIF data and that worker IAM scope is read-only on source buckets. Sign-off required from the Quillhaven security rotation. The verified build is identified by the token below.

session token of bawep-yadup = htk21_528abd376e3c5a4ec24a1